AwardKit vs Evessio. Live in 30 Minutes, Not 15 Days.

Evessio powers many of the UK’s B2B media awards, with a strong ceremony stack and support reviewers rave about. But it is sales-led: no public prices, no free trial, and your branded site is delivered by their team in 15 days to 8 weeks. AwardKit is a public flat $1,995 a year for unlimited programs, and you launch it yourself the same afternoon. Here is an honest, line by line comparison.

The Short Version

AwardKit vs Evessio in Four Bullets

AwardKit is a public flat $1,995 a year for unlimited programs. Evessio publishes no prices: quotes are scoped by how many programs you run, the module you need, and a service tier. The only public number is a G2-listed starting price of $2,400 a year for one Awards module.

AwardKit is fully self-serve: sign up, build, and launch in under 30 minutes with no demo. Evessio is demo-led, and its own pricing page describes site delivery in 15 days on an existing theme, or 4 to 8 weeks for custom work.

AwardKit lets you build your entire program for free and pay only when you open submissions. Evessio advertises no free trial; G2 confirms none is offered.

Both platforms charge zero commission on entry fees and include unlimited entries. Evessio is genuinely ahead on ceremony logistics (seating, tables, ticketing) and custom domains; we call that out honestly.

When Evessio is the right choice

  • The gala is the center of your program and you want seating plans, table bookings, ticketing, and guest management in the same system as entries and judging. AwardKit does not do ceremony logistics.
  • You want your award site on your own domain today. Evessio includes custom domains with SSL on every site; AwardKit does not offer them yet.
  • You want a vendor to design and build the site for you, with an account-managed relationship and support that reviewers consistently call second to none.
  • You run awards and conferences from one team and want both on one platform with a single login.
  • You need API access or a multi-language interface out of the box.
